    Life insurance on dead husbands mortgage
    My huband passed away a little over a year ago,and I'm not on the deed or mortgage on our home,I believe he had life insurance on said mortgage,is the insurance co. legally bound to disclose this information to me? If not how can I find this info out?

    Fr_Chuck

    If you are not on the deed or the mortgage, it will of course have to go into probate, ** assuming the US**
    This will include other property or money that was not owned jointly properly.

    The person who is appointed by the will or the court over the estate will supply the lender legal notice of this and ask for information

    Please clarify - did your husband carry a life insurance policy? Or did he have mortgage insurance? They are two different things. A life insurance policy would pay out to the benficiary, and people often carry such a policy so that the mortgage can be paid off. If that's what your husband had, you need to contact the life insurance company (not the mortgage company). Mortgage insurance is different - it protects the lender in case the lender fails to pay and the mortgage goes into default. It doesn't pay off the mortgage itself, but rather gives some protection to the lender in case after foreclosure they can't recoup their loan. Now that your husband has died assuming you are have inherited the property from him you need to retitle the deed and either pay off the existing mortgage or refinance it in your name.
